Marquez could have made it into turn 1 just as well without the extra couple of feet that he took away from Luthi, and as a Grand Prix rider of his caliber, he should know this. So I'm voting with the mob on this one... it was dirty.

As for the motor... not sure that Marc Marquez has any speed advantage other than just getting a good drive off the last corner. Here's a speed chart from the MotoGP website.

Moto2 Top Race Speeds

Pos | No | Rider | Nation | Bike | Average | Top
1|4 |Randy KRUMMENACHER |SWI |KALEX |281.8 |285.0
2|80 |Esteve RABAT |SPA |KALEX |282.9 |284.2
3|40 |Pol ESPARGARO |SPA |KALEX |281.7 |282.9
4|49 |Axel PONS |SPA |KALEX | 280.7 |281.5
5|93 |Marc MARQUEZ |SPA |SUTER |278.8 |281.0
6|18 |Nicolas TEROL |SPA |SUTER |279.3 |280.9
7|60 |Julian SIMON |SPA |FTR |279.7 |280.4
8|30 |Takaaki NAKAGAMI |JPN |KALEX |279.5 |280.3
9|45 |Scott REDDING |GBR |KALEX |278.6 |280.3
10|5 |Johann ZARCO |FRA |MOTOBI | 278.2 |279.6
11|72 |Yuki TAKAHASHI |JPN |SUTER |276.9 |279.5
12|15 |Alex DE ANGELIS |RSM |SUTER |278.1 |278.5
13|3 |Simone CORSI |ITA |FTR |277.7 |278.4
14|7 |Alexander LUNDH |SWE MZ |FTR |274.6 |278.3
15|63 |Mike DI MEGLIO |FRA |SPEED UP |278.0 |278.2
16|12 |Thomas LUTHI |SWI |SUTER |277.8 |278.1
17|76 |Max NEUKIRCHNER |GER |KALEX | 275.5 |278.1
18|77 |Dominique AEGERTER |SWI |SUTER |277.9 |278.1
19|36 |Mika KALLIO |FIN |KALEX |277.3 |277.9
20|82 |Elena ROSELL |SPA |MORIWAKI | 271.5 |277.9
21|71 |Claudio CORTI |ITA |KALEX |276.9 |277.8
22|24 |Toni ELIAS |SPA |SUTER |277.2 |277.7
23|29 |Andrea IANNONE |ITA |SPEED UP | 277.2 |277.5
